Project Manager hired at the Brown Center for Faculty Innovation and Excellence

Katherine McCladdie joins Stetson University’s staff as Project Manager for the new Brown Center for Faculty Innovation and Excellence, beginning November 2, 2015. As project manager, Ms. McCladdie’s primary role will be advancing the goals, success initiatives, and activities of the Brown Center for Faculty Innovation and Excellence through professional and administrative roles. Annual Poverty Conference Attracts 283 Participants

Stetson University hosted the 2nd annual Poverty and Homelessness Conference on October 23, 2015.  A student panel (below) provided testimony on the plight of homelessness in the U.S. According ti conference founder, Rajni Shankar-Brown, participants included educators, activists, and members of the community. Brown Innovation Fellows Program names professors | Stetson Today

The Brown Innovation Fellows Program at Stetson University offers teacher-scholar faculty dedicated time for study and reflection on learning as well as strategies to facilitate deep, integrative student learning anchored in Stetson’s mission of preparing students to lead lives steeped in personal growth, intellectual development, and global citizenship. Congratulations to the following Stetson University’s 2015-2016 Brown Innovation Fellows:
